Uncovering the Real Story of Your Workday
Traditional time tracking — manually logging hours in Toggl or Harvest — is useful for billing but useless for personal productivity because it captures what you think you did. AI-powered tools like RescueTime, Timely, Rize, and Clockify's AI features passively monitor application usage, document focus, tab activity, and calendar events, then use machine learning to categorize activities automatically. No manual timers needed; the system observes and builds an accurate picture of your day.
The insights are often uncomfortable. One software engineer discovered through Rize that his "two hours of deep coding" was actually 45 minutes of coding interrupted by 11 context switches. His perceived 2-hour block was 45 minutes of work fragmented across 2 hours of calendar time. This is what best AI tools for time management reveal — not judgment, but clarity. You can't fix what you can't see.
From Insight to Behavioral Change
Raw data without action is mere trivia. The value of AI productivity tools for work lies in translating patterns into concrete recommendations. These tools identify your chronotype based on output — not self-perception — and suggest optimal schedules. They quantify context-switching costs so you make informed trade-offs about notifications. Deep work with AI focus techniques becomes compelling when data proves your best code or strategy happens between 8:00 and 10:30 AM — and meetings during that window measurably reduce output. One product manager used RescueTime data to negotiate with her team: morning meetings reduced afternoon output by roughly 40%. The team shifted meetings to afternoons, weekly output rose. Data transforms subjective preferences into objective cases for change — not surveillance, but self-awareness enabling better decisions about your most finite resource.
